[According
to
RAND Report, Vol.
1
,
2002,
"Everybody
sat in
airports,
so
therewas no
1ST
for two, three
days,"
said one firefighter-special-operations panelist."It had a big
effect.
The
first
timeItalkedtoanybodyon aFEMA radio
off-site
was on the
third
day
because they
just
didn't
get
there."]
